
Senegal midfielder, Issa Ndiaye has been sacked by Moroccan second division club, USM Oujda, DAILY POST reports.
Ndiayeās contract was terminated after he allegedly mocked the Confederation of African Football, CAF, decision to award the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ations title to Morocco
The playerās public comments was deemed disrespectful by USM Oujda.
CAFās appeal board stripped Senegal of the AFCON 2025 title on Tuesday.
The board ruled that the Terangha Lions decision to walk off the pitch for 17 minutes during the final violated the competitionās regulations.
The West Africans won the thrilling final 1-0.
